Default Engine Chip

Got a 03 coupe...looking to change the computer chip. How much horsepower gain can you get and where can I get the chip ???

You don't change chips in the C5. You reflash the computer. Hypertech, Predator, Dyno tune. Don't really know how much you'll gain. I'm sure someone will know.

If you don't have any other mods don't waste your $$$. You might get a little hp & tq from a dyno tune, but not anything astounding. If you want a nice kick in the pants get yourself a good CA intake and maybe gears. Both will be money well spent IMO.
